Компоненты и технологии, № 6'2004
В мир xDSL - с STMicroelectronics
Часть 2. Станционная часть xDSL
В первой части статьи рассказывалось о чипсетах и готовых решениях абонентской части АРБ!. от БТМкгое!есГгошс5 — об ДРБЬ-модемах. Понятно, что нужна и ответная часть — станционная. Если к абоненту в квартиру идет всего одна линия, то на телефонную станцию их приходит сотни, поэтому есть тенденция к увеличению канальности РМТ-чипа. К чему это приводит — объяснять не надо: уменьшение размеров платы, уменьшение удельной стоимости линии, уменьшение энергопотребления. Все это позволяет сэкономить средства и быть более конкурентоспособным на рынке.
Игорь Лепихин
Начнем с основного чипсета, представляемого STMicroelectronics — COPPERWING.
Если вспомнить организацию ADSL-модема (микросхема модема, аналоговый интерфейс и драйвер линии), то здесь STMicroelectronics продолжает тенденцию использования отдельных микросхем. Идея состоит в том, чтобы унифицировать аналоговые интерфейсы с последующими разработками, например с PeakSHDSL, речь о котором пойдет ниже. Обратимся к истории чипсетов ОТ ADSL. В 1999 году STMicroelectronics выпустила одноканальный чипсет, который представлял собой фактически обычный ADSL-модем, только устанавливаемый на станционной стороне. Состоял он из DMT-модема, аналогового интерфейса и двух драйверов: приемного и передающего. Этот чипсет имел ряд недостатков. Во-первых, одноканальное решение сильно ограничивало его применение в станционной части из-за громоздкости получаемого решения, где каналов насчитываются сотни. Во-вторых, по энергопотреблению такая схема оставляла желать лучшего. Наконец, несовершенная технология того времени делала чип большим и не давала возможности поддерживать большое количество стандартов. Следующим шагом, который и является основным сейчас, стало производство восьмиканального чипа модема, легшего в основу чипсета COPPERWING. Здесь число каналов в DMT-модеме увеличилось до 8, число каналов аналогового интерфейса увеличилось до 4, а драйвера линии так и остались одноканальными. Оно и правильно, потому что в качестве драйверов линии используются обычные операционные усилители, но с расширенным частотным диапазоном, таким образом, их можно использовать не только в качестве драйверов ADSL-линий, но и, например, в качестве широкополосных усилителей. Наконец, в разработке у STMicroelectronics находится 12-канальный DMT-чип, который уже вызывает ажиотаж среди европейских производителей ADSL-оборудования. Этот чип позволит еще больше сэкономить место
116
на плате, уменьшить энергопотребление, а новая технология позволит еще и уменьшить стоимость микросхемы. Теперь более подробно о чипсете, который сейчас используется — о чипсете COPPER-WING8, то есть 8-канальном DMT-чипе ADSL, имеющем название STLC60845.
В российских сетях наиболее употребим стандарт ADSL Annex A. Если же речь идет о гибкости устройства, о его применимости вне российских сетей, то лучше, если бы «ядро» такой системы было масштабируемым и могло поддерживать и другие приложения ADSL. Вот таким чипсетом и является COPPERWING8. Его технические характеристики:
• Поддержка до 8 портов на одном чипе.
• Чип поддерживает несколько стандартов ADSL: ITU-T G.992.1 (G.dmt) Annex A, B, C и ITU-T G.992.2 (G.lite), ANSI T1.413 Issue 2 и ETSI TS101 388.
• Поддерживает скорости: до 12 Мбит/с входящего потока и до 2 Мбит/с исходящего.
• Длина линии может составлять до 6,5 км.
• Функциональность второй категории: кодирование несущей и эхоподавление.
• Гибкие возможности для изменения конфигурации: поддержка ADSL over POTS, ADSL over ISDN и симметричные каналы (увеличение скорости исходящего потока).
• Нормальный и пониженный режим фрейминга.
• Поддерживает 1-битовую констелляцию.
• Интерфейсы: ATM (UTOPIA Level 1, Level 2) и STM (последовательные интерфейсы).
• Поддержка ATM-ячеек двойной длины.
• Поддерживает параллельное использование интерфейсов ATM и STM в двойном режиме (быстрый и ускоренный).
• Поддерживает режим внутридиапазонного управления через интерфейс UTOPIA.
• Поддерживает загрузку по интерфейсу UTOPIA.
• Параллельный интерфейс с процессором или последовательный интерфейс для беспроцессорных карт. Полный программный стек протоколов/API.
• Потребляемая мощность 125 мВт/канал.
-------www.finestreet.ru-------------------------
Компоненты и технологии, № 6'2004
I
HOST l/F
USER
l/F
ACU
DMT
MODEM X 8
AFE
l/F
PLL
17,004 МГц или 35,328 МГц
Рис. 1. Структурная схема STLC60845
Тх1
Rxl
Тх2
Rx3
ТхЗ
Rx3
Тх4
Rx5
• Интерфейс JTAG.
• Температурный диапазон: -40... +85 °С.
Итак, как видно, возможностей у данного
чипсета предостаточно. Он может работать практически с любым типом линий и поддерживать огромное количество стандартов. Структурная схема STLC60845 (рис. 1) еще раз доказывает, что все гениальное — просто.
Здесь есть три интерфейсных блока, PLL, ACU и DMT. Теперь обо всем по порядку.
Интерфейсные блоки содержат интерфейс пользователя, предназначенный для загрузки данных, которые будут переданы по ADSL-каналу. К этим интерфейсам и относятся UTOPIA и последовательный STM-интерфейс. Возможен выбор одного из них либо комбинация одного и другого. Хост-интерфейс служит для сопряжения микросхемы с внешним управляющим процессором. Здесь также доступно несколько вариантов шины: параллельная (обычный порт ввода-вывода) либо последовательная (при которой STLC60845 подключается к последовательному порту микроконтроллера). Этот режим обеспечивает возможность проектирования бесконтроллерной карты. Наконец, AFE-интерфейс служит для прямого подключения к аналоговому препроцессору (который входит в чипсет COPPERWING). Этот интерфейс содержит последовательный канал управления, а также параллельный интерфейс ЦАП/АЦП. Микросхема также имеет 8-разрядный порт ввода-вывода, который построен в не совсем обычной манере. Каждая линейка порта представляет собой последовательную линию одного из модемов, по которой подаются API-команды, когда модем не находится в состоянии RESET. Каждая линия может быть установлена либо в режим записи, либо в режим чтения, а также может быть индивидуально прочтена или записана.
О назначении PLL особо много рассказывать нет смысла. Его назначение — умножение частоты. Наибольший интерес представляет ядро, которое состоит из двух частей: DMT и ACU. ACU (ADSL Channel Unit) — это, собственно говоря, набор интерфейсов для работы ADSL-каналов с внешним миром, и эти интерфейсы уже описывались вы---------------------www.finestreet.ru -
ше. DMT состоит из двух частей: частотной и временной. Частотный блок отвечает за все операции по обработке фреймов. Он осуществляет преобразование между амплитудно-фазо-модулированными сигналами в частотной области для каждой частоты и соответствующей серией временных кадров. Также в этом блоке осуществляется регулировка амплитудно-частотного баланса. Одной из основных и самых ресурсоемких процедур, которые осуществляет DMT, является прямое и обратное преобразование Фурье.
Временная часть DMT-блока осуществляет обработку кадров во временной области, а также балансировку по амплитуде во временной области, эхоподавление, интерполяцию и децимацию для интерфейса с AFE.
Каждый модем содержит встроенный DSP, который отвечает за установку модема и контролирует модем во время загрузки и работы. Все восемь DSP совершенно независимы, таким образом, работа или остановка одного модема никак не скажется на работе остальных. Более того, каждый DSP отвечает за статистику производительности по своему каналу, и при использовании гибкого DSP-софта предоставляет большие возможности по отладке и конфигурированию.
Теперь перейдем к описанию микросхемы аналогового препроцессора STLC60444, который также входит в состав чипсета COPPER-WING. Основным назначением этого препроцессора или аналогового интерфейса является преобразование данных из цифрового вида в аналоговый и обратно, поэтому в основе чипа лежит блок аналого-цифровых и цифро-аналоговых преобразователей (рис. 2). Вот некоторые характеристики этого чипа:
• Содержит четыре законченных полноскоростных ADSL-препроцессора.
• Содержит все активные цепи за исключением драйверов линии.
• Низкое энергопотребление при питании 3,3 В (200 мВт/порт G.lite и 235 мВт/порт G.dmt).
• Содержит встроенные аналоговые фильтры и 15-разрядные ЦАП и АЦП.
• Интерполяционная фильтрация для уменьшения скорости передающего канала.
• Промышленный температурный диапазон.
Как видно, микросхема имеет четыре блока преобразователей, общую шину, а также интерфейсные и управляющие устройства. Каждый преобразователь содержит аналогоцифровой преобразователь, цифро-аналоговый преобразователь, интерполяционные фильтры, а также программируемый усилитель мощности приемной стороны. Разрядность преобразователей составляет 15 бит, а скорость достигает 2 миллионов преобразований в секунду для обеспечения приемлемой скорости передачи. Динамический диапазон операционного усилителя составляет 40 дБ. Усилитель мощности является программируемым и управляется соответствующими регистрами микросхемы STLC60444. Блок преобразователей содержит также фильтры со следующими центральными частотами: 150 кГц (POTS), 300 кГц (ISDN), а также 600 кГц и 1200 кГц. Фильтры, как и все остальные устройства, тоже являются цифровыми и настраиваются соответствующими регистрами. Что касается интерфейсов, здесь все очень просто: это последовательный трехпроводной управляющий интерфейс и интерфейс прямого сопряжения с микросхемой STLC60845.
Стоит также упомянуть микросхему STLC60844, которую STMicroelectronics также предлагает использовать с чипсетом COP-PERWING. Она представляет собой не 4-, а 8-канальный аналоговый интерфейс для микросхемы STLC60845, и по функциональности полностью идентична STLC60444.
Наконец, последняя составляющая чипсета COPPERWING — это драйвер линии. Здесь предлагается к использованию несколько вариантов. Либо использовать стандартные одноканальные или двухканальные широкополосные усилители серии TS61x, либо использовать специальные изготовленные для ADSL-чипсета 8-канальные драйверы линий STLC60133, которые имеют полосу 140 МГц и плоскую часть характеристики шириной 30 МГц. Таким образом, при использовании микросхем STLC60845, STLC60844 и STLC60133 можно сделать 8-канальный станционный модем всего на трех микросхемах. Различные варианты решения COPPERWING показаны на рис. 3.
Компоненты и технологии, № ó'2004
FOR OCTAL/QUAD SOLUTION Host CPU
FOR FULL OCTAL SOLUTION
Host CPU
Host CPU
<4 ► COPPERWING COPPERWING
STLC60845 «—► STLCÓ0844
Octal ADSL
Transceiver Octal AFE
f STLC60133M Л Line Driver J •
•
J STLC60133N > Line Driver J
Рис. 3. Варианты решения COPPERWING
Наконец, то, без чего обычно не обходится ни один серьезный проект, — отладочное средство для набора микросхем. Существует специальный отладочный комплект, который имеет название COPPERWING EVALUATION MODULE. Состоит этот набор из трех компонентов. Основным компонентом является, конечно же, плата с чипсетом COPPERWING8 (8-канальным). Устанавливается вариант: STLC60845, две микросхемы STLC60444 и одна микросхема STLC6133. Все необходимые кнопки, соединители, кабели и т. д. прилагаются. Вторым компонентом, который входит в отладочный набор, является плата сопряжения с ПК. Эта плата служит для программирования и отладки чипсета COPPERWING с по-
мощью программы OMANA, которая является третьей составляющей отладочного набора.
Программное обеспечение OMANA может использоваться не только с отладочным набором COPPERWING, но и с ADSL-картой уже готового продукта. OMANA используется для управления и анализа чипсета COP-PERWING, включающего 8 независимых ADSL-модемов. Для ее использования отладочный набор или ADSL-карта подключается через ту самую плату сопряжения с ПК, которая у STMicroelectronics носит название FDC (Fast Debugger Card — карта быстрой отладки). Программа OMANA позволяет конфигурировать модемы от «А» до «Я», в том числе старт системы и загрузку моде-
мов, отображать статус и производительность системы, управлять системными функциями (пуск, останов модема; установление, разрыв соединения и пр.). Более того, в версии OMANA 3.0 (текущая поставляемая версия) появилась возможность подключать более одного чипсета COPPERWING, а это значит, что данное программное обеспечение можно использовать не только для отладки, но также и для конфигурирования и контроля производительности реальной станции с чипсетом COPPERWING.
В последнее время очень часто возникает вопрос о перспективах того или иного семейства микросхем. Чипсет COPPERWING постоянно развивается и, таким образом, имеет очень большие перспективы. В конце этого года в массовое производство пойдет чипсет COPPERWING12, который основан на новой микросхеме STLC61255. Эта микросхема практически ничем не отличается от микросхемы STLC60845, но содержит не 8, а 12 независимых ADSL-модемов. Наконец, также в конце года появится 12-канальный мульти-протокольный чип STLC61256, который помимо ADSL со всеми его дополнениями сможет работать также в перспективных стандартах ADSL2, ADSL2+, а также на симметричных линиях, работающих в стандарте SHDSL и LDSL.
Сделав сейчас ставку на чипсет COPPER-WING, производитель получает популярный и быстроразвивающийся набор микросхем на далекую перспективу, для которого «ГАММА Санкт-Петербург» и STMicroelectronics осуществляют беспрецедентную по масштабам техническую поддержку. В рамках поддержки бесплатно предоставляется полноценное схемотехническое решение с перечнем элементов. В состав отладочного набора входят библиотеки протоколов разных уровней. А если назвать стоимость одной линии при использовании чипсета COPPERWING, то конкурентам не останется ни единого шанса.
118
www.finestreet.ru